The Well Endowed Podcast tells stories about the people and organizations shaping Edmonton and the region. For its 2026 production cycle, the Edmonton Community Foundation wanted to move production out of house and raise the show’s production quality starting with its 210th episode.

Haq is producing the show with a flexible process designed for each episode’s mix of host narration, guest interviews and supplied material while maintaining one consistent, recognizable series.

The Foundation supplies the production briefs and scripts. Haq provides support when needed and translates them into a practical production and post-production plan; records host segments and interviews in a comfortable, professional studio; organizes audio and video assets; assembles varied segments; handles audio editing, sound design, mixing, mastering and delivery; and keeps each episode on schedule.

Sample Episode: A Bird in Hand

In this episode of The Well-Endowed Podcast, co-host Andrew Paul travels to the Beaverhill Natural Area, where he joins Assistant Biologist John Van Arragon and his crew during one of the final bird-monitoring nights of the season. Together, they explore how scientific research, community education, and ECF’s Environmental Operating Grants are helping protect Alberta’s migratory birds and build the capacity to continue this vital work for generations to come.
